Title

EVALUATION OF NITROGEN FERTILIZER APPLICATION AND SEED INOCULATION BY AZOTOBACTER AND AZOSPRILLIUM ON YIELD, RATE AND GRAIN FILLING PERIOD OF CORN SC-500 CULTIVAR

Pages

  1-15

Abstract

 In order to evaluation of NITROGEN FERTILIZER application and seed inoculation by Azotobacter and Azosprillium on YIELD, rate and GRAIN FILLING PERIOD of CORN SC-500 cultivar, a factorial experiment was conducted based on randomized complete block design with three replications in farm of Agriculture and Natural Resource research center of Azarbaijan-e- Shargi province in 2011. The factors were included: nitrogen rates in four levels (0, 60, 120 and 180 kg/ha form urea) as N0, N1, N2 and N3 respectively and seed inoculation with rhizobacteria (without inoculation as control, seed inoculation with Azotobacter chrocococum strain 5, Azosprillium lipoferum strain OF). The results showed that maximum of nitrogen use efficiency (35.13 kg/kg) was obtained in application of 60 kg N/ha and minimum of it (23.37 kg/kg) was in application of 180 kg N/ha. Seed inoculation with bio fertilizers increased nitrogen use efficiency compared to no seed inoculation. Nitrogen rates and seed inoculation with bio fertilizers had significantly effects on YIELD and YIELD components. Maximum of grain YIELD (9313.3 kg/ha), grain weight (0.31 gr), rate (0.0089 gr/day) and GRAIN FILLING PERIOD (54.37 day) were obtained in seed inoculation with Azosprillium ×180 kg N ha-1. So, in order to increasing of grain YIELD, rate and GRAIN FILLING PERIOD can be suggested that be applied 180 kg N ha-1 × seed inoculation with Azospirillum lipoferum.
